You have to load them first into photoshop.



In the action pallette click on the little black arrow in the upper right corner, there will be a drop down menu. Highlight "LOAD ACTIONS" and click on it a menu window should open, locate where you saved the actions and click the load button. The actions should now be listed in your palette. Click on the actual action ( it should appear right under the set that was installed and hit play at the bottom of the palette.)



If you want to use it more than once double click the action and you can select a function key to use for the action, this makes things easier if you have to use it a lot.
